Output db663ed511df4b51436c0b3d2f5c2e60ebbfb16b97828fe72825fa91b785fdac:0

value
1055594
script pubkey
OP_0 OP_PUSHBYTES_20 e10cfc6e4489bbba67b17cc4b3047af125105806
address
bc1quyx0cmjy3xam5ea30nztxpr67yj3qkqxtn2z6x
transaction
db663ed511df4b51436c0b3d2f5c2e60ebbfb16b97828fe72825fa91b785fdac
confirmations
17730
spent
true